TEACHING EXPERIENCE

I've been teaching since 1995, and teaching Forensic Science since 2008. I teach mostly Biology and Forensic Science. I do not use a textbook. My Forensic class is lab and skill-based, and I write my own curriculum.

MY TEACHING STYLE

Students learn Science best by actually doing Science.

HONORS/AWARDS/SHINING TEACHER MOMENT

National Board Certified Teacher

MY OWN EDUCATIONAL HISTORY

BA in Biology Education, BA in Spanish, MS in Biology (Marine & Estuarine Science Program)
